Deck Sealing in Kitsap County, WA

Deck sealing services involve applying protective finishes to outdoor wooden or composite decks to help prevent damage from moisture, UV rays, and general wear over time. This service is suitable for a variety of projects, including residential decks, porches, and patios that require a barrier to extend the lifespan of the surface. Homeowners typically seek deck sealing to maintain the appearance of their outdoor spaces, reduce the risk of wood rot or warping, and preserve the integrity of the decking materials.

Before requesting deck sealing, property owners often want to understand the condition of their existing deck, including whether it needs cleaning, sanding, or repairs prior to sealing. It’s also helpful to know the type of decking material, as different finishes may be recommended based on whether the surface is wood, composite, or another material. Clarifying the desired level of gloss or finish, along with any specific concerns about weather exposure or foot traffic, can ensure the sealing process provides the best protection and appearance for the outdoor space.

FAQ

Deck Sealing Questions

What is deck sealing? Deck sealing involves applying a protective coating to the surface of a deck to help prevent damage from moisture, UV rays, and wear.

Why should homeowners consider deck sealing? Sealing helps extend the lifespan of a deck by reducing the risk of wood rot, cracking, and warping caused by exposure to the elements.

What types of decks benefit most from sealing? Wooden decks, especially those exposed to frequent moisture or sunlight, benefit most from regular sealing to maintain their appearance and durability.

How often should a deck be resealed? It is generally recommended to reseal a deck every one to three years, depending on weather conditions and the type of sealant used.
